By default, renting a condominium by the night (under 30 days) is treated as hotel-type business under Thailand's Hotel Act B.E. 2547 and is restricted for condos by Section 17/1 of the Condominium Act — with real penalties reported since enforcement tightened in 2025–2026. The commonly cited exemption is residential leasing of 30 days or longer. The kit's regulatory checklist maps exactly which questions to verify with a licensed Thai lawyer — it is information to act on, not legal advice.
